i have two identical mats running off a microclimate stat- and it is a complete pain in the neck- ive tried EVERYTHING to get them to run together, but the one without the stat probe is always slightly warmer than the other one, and sometimes rockets up to 30+ for no apparent reason, giving me minor heart attacks.
i have in fact recently decided to give up on the experiment- and get another stat.
i have heard that habistat are better than microclimate tho- so it could work for you, and loads of the Knowledgable Bods seem to think its do-able... its worth a try, you can always change it later if yr not happy
